Our not so little boy is finally here! Ansen was born at 10:50 pm on Jan. 27. He weighed 9 lbs and was 20.5 inches long. Not as big as his sister but he was a week early!

And here's the story behind his birth:

On Jan. 7 I went into preterm labor caused by a UTI. After 8 hours of monitoring and fluids I was sent home. 2 weeks later I started getting contractions~it just happened to be the worst day to travel and I was getting worried as the contractions started to get closer as the roads were awful and we'd be safer delivering at home than travelling. Troy started reading up on it. About 3 hours into, all stopped.

At my 39 week appointment, we reminded the doc that we were 110 miles away and the other hospital was 86 miles; plus there was another winter storm coming in a few days. They decided to induce that afternoon. I was admitted at4 pm and they gave me my first does of Cervidex (or something similar) around 6 pm. The doc was then going home and would break my water in the morning.

2 hours later my water broke and I was at a 5. The nurse called the doc back in. My contractions picked up and were right on top of each other. I started an IV of fluids to prep for my epidural. The anatesioligst (sp) was just down stairs and should be up in 20 minutes I was told. 45 minutes later he arrives making it about 10:15-10:30pm. I was yelling at him to hurry up but he insisted to wait for the alcohol to dry on my back. (Standard I'm sure but I didn't want to wait!) As I leaned forward for the numbing shot, little Ansen decided to fall into place and the anasteiologist was whisked out of the room and Ansen was born with NO drugs! OUCH!!! He was very alert and cried ALOT (well for about 20 minutes)! But then he was given back to me and we both felt better. :) He took to nursing well and sleeps like a newborn (every 2 hours).

I developed Mastitis 3-4 days later but after antibiotics that healed. Kaylei has really taken to her baby brother and showers him with love at every available moment. She likes to hold him and have him sit by her in the bouncy seat. She is currently taking a nap next to his bassinet.
